-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我有一个 Flash 项目,我需要将文件保存到用户本地计算机。我曾认为 Flash 包含用于处理文件的工具,但显然这在 Flash Player 10 出现之前不会实现。
我正在使用 ActionScript 3 使用 CS3,我认为也许 Jugglor 工具 JSave 可能能够完成我想做的事情,但是在 Flash MX 之后在任何东西上使用 JSave 的文档基本上不存在。
有谁知道如何在 ActionScript 3 中使用 JSave 来保存文件或有更好的解决方案在 Flash 中保存文件?
谢谢
最佳答案
如果您愿意将您的应用程序从 Web 带到桌面,Adobe AIR 就是您的解决方案。通过 Adobe Update Manager 更新您的 Flash CS3 安装,您将能够在 Flash 应用程序中使用 Adobe AIR。
编辑:如果您的应用程序需要留在网络上,您可以使用 AS3 类 FileReference 来实例化操作系统下载对话框并以这种方式将文件保存到用户的计算机上,但您将无法指定用户系统上的位置创建文件或是否创建文件,因为这取决于用户决定做什么。
根据您需要完成的任务,您可以使用本地共享对象。这本质上是 Flash 的 cookie 版本。
关于flash - 保存文件 ActionScript 3.0 + Jugglor 和 JSave,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/746057/
我有一个 Flash 项目,我需要将文件保存到用户本地计算机。我曾认为 Flash 包含用于处理文件的工具,但显然这在 Flash Player 10 出现之前不会实现。 我正在使用 ActionSc
我是一名优秀的程序员,十分优秀!